Frequently asked questions

One Moorgate Place offers several event spaces including the Great Hall (cabaret or theatre style seating), Main Reception Room (for catering throughout the day), Auditorium (theatre/classroom style), Atrium (standing catering space), Member's Room (boardroom setting for up to 28 guests), and One Moorgate Place Club (for drinks and canapes). The venue can accommodate events from 28 guests up to 200+ depending on the space and layout chosen.

The DDR package costs £100-£129 per person plus VAT depending on numbers, with minimum numbers of 65-80 required. It includes exclusive room hire from 7am-5pm, arrival tea/coffee with pastries, mid-morning refreshments, finger buffet lunch, afternoon tea/coffee with cake, unlimited mineral water, standard AV package with lectern, microphones, screens, projector, PA system, live streaming capability, WiFi access, delegate stationery, and cloakroom facilities.

Evening reception packages include unlimited house wines, bottled beers and soft drinks with canapes and bowl food. A 4-hour reception package costs £103.20 per person plus VAT for 150 guests, including exclusive venue hire from 5pm-11pm, 4 canapes and 4 bowls per person. Shorter packages like 1-2 hour drinks receptions start from £22.50-£42 per person plus VAT with minimum numbers of 80.

AV technician support is mandatory for most events at £500-£600 plus VAT. This includes video conferencing and live streaming package at no additional charge. Standard AV equipment (screens, projectors, microphones, PA system) is included in room hire, but technician support is required for operation during events.

Seated dinner packages cost £126-£151.20 per person plus VAT and include exclusive room hire from 6pm-11pm, 45 minutes unlimited sparkling wine, 4 canapes per person, 3-course set menu dinner, half bottle of house wine, unlimited mineral water, tea/coffee with petit fours, table centerpieces, standard linen, standard AV setup, printed menus, event management, and cloakroom. Minimum numbers of 130 guests are required.

Public liability insurance is mandatory as a condition for hosting events. To proceed with booking, you must provide full company name, billing address, contract signatory details with email address, and proof of public liability insurance. Contracts are issued via DocuSign, invoices are sent once signed contracts are received, and you'll be introduced to the operations team for final event details.

Dates are offered on either 1st option (confirmed availability) or 2nd option (provisional hold). The venue can provisionally hold dates while you make decisions. Some larger spaces may be unavailable on certain dates, and the venue will suggest alternative dates if your preferred date is not available.

The venue has minimum budget requirements and will decline proposals if the maximum budget is insufficient for their packages. For example, they declined a £60 per person budget request, indicating their packages typically start higher. They provide reduced rates for certain packages but maintain minimum spending thresholds for most event types.

The venue offers various catering options including finger buffet lunches (£32.50-£54 per person plus VAT), fork buffet lunches, arrival refreshments (£5.75-£6.90 per person plus VAT), and drinks on consumption basis. They can accommodate specific dietary requirements and have current menus available for reference. Some events can combine different catering elements rather than using set packages.

Events typically run during business hours with some flexibility for evening events until 11pm-midnight. Host access is usually provided 1 hour before guest arrival (e.g., 5pm host access for 6pm guest arrival). Setup time can be arranged, including evening before access for rehearsals (4 hours for setup/rehearsal). Breakdown time is factored into event scheduling with specific departure times agreed in advance.
